The Light Metal Fixings are most commonly used to fix profiled metal, cladding single skin or insulation to light metal steel and purlins up to 4.5 mm thick. With unique carbide dies the fixing screw point is manufactured to give the perfect size pilot hold for ultimate thread engagement.

Our self tap tech screws are Phoenix Steels most commonly sold fixing. These screws are suitable for all grades of chip wood, Plywood, Soft and Hard wood. Timber Tech Screws are available in various length ranging from 20 ml to 110 ml.
The Heavy Metal screws now has the most extensive range of the fasteners for heavy metal steel and purlins. The latest forged point technology are now built and designed to remove any problems that originally occured with these fixings such as skidding and a slow drill speed times.
